Softsqueeze does not decode WMA - it needs Slimserver to do it. On Linux this is normally done by ffmpeg or mplayer. These app will work on a MIPS processor but decoding will be slow as MIPS processor does not have hardware Floating Point support.
Ffmpeg or mplayer could work for WMA files but the decoding process will probably be too slow for WMA broadcats streams. The only way to be sure it to try it. If you do try it send a WAV stream to SoftSqueeze - the additional processing for a FLAC or MP3 stream may be too much of a load on the Linkstation.
